We're moving! From July 1 2019, Great Yarmouth & Waveney Mind will be part of the newly formed Norfolk and Waveney Mind. The merge brings together three Norfolk-based Minds, and we will be operating from www.norfolkandwaveneymind.org.uk. Please bear with us while we transition to our new online home.​

Our Services

Established in 1978, Great Yarmouth & Waveney Mind has extensive experience in providing mental health services for people across Great Yarmouth & Waveney
